| <div class="method"> |
| <code class="details" id="list">list(appsId, environment=None, x__xgafv=None)</code> |
| <pre>Lists all the available runtimes for the application. |
| |
| Args: |
| appsId: string, Part of `parent`. Required. Name of the parent Application resource. Example: apps/myapp. (required) |
| environment: string, Optional. The environment of the Application. |
| Allowed values |
| ENVIRONMENT_UNSPECIFIED - Default value. |
| STANDARD - App Engine Standard. |
| FLEXIBLE - App Engine Flexible |
| x__xgafv: string, V1 error format. |
| Allowed values |
| 1 - v1 error format |
| 2 - v2 error format |
| |
| Returns: |
| An object of the form: |
| |
| { # Response message for Applications.ListRuntimes. |
| "nextPageToken": "A String", # Continuation token for fetching the next page of results. |
| "runtimes": [ # The runtimes available to the requested application. |
| { # Runtime versions for App Engine. |
| "decommissionedDate": { # Represents a whole or partial calendar date, such as a birthday. The time of day and time zone are either specified elsewhere or are insignificant. The date is relative to the Gregorian Calendar. This can represent one of the following: A full date, with non-zero year, month, and day values. A month and day, with a zero year (for example, an anniversary). A year on its own, with a zero month and a zero day. A year and month, with a zero day (for example, a credit card expiration date).Related types: google.type.TimeOfDay google.type.DateTime google.protobuf.Timestamp # Date when Runtime is decommissioned. |
| "day": 42, # Day of a month. Must be from 1 to 31 and valid for the year and month, or 0 to specify a year by itself or a year and month where the day isn't significant. |
| "month": 42, # Month of a year. Must be from 1 to 12, or 0 to specify a year without a month and day. |
| "year": 42, # Year of the date. Must be from 1 to 9999, or 0 to specify a date without a year. |
| }, |
